Abstract

Systems and methods for enabling multi-factor authentication for a web-based account. A first computing device and a second computing device are accessible to a first user. A backend system is accessible to a second user. The backend system communicates with the second computing device via a secure communication network. The first user creates a web-based account and receives a MFA initiation screen including secret information and a field for entering at least one TOTP token. The backend system has a TOTP token generator. The second computing device captures the secret information and transmits it to the backend system. The second user generates at least one TOTP token using the backend system and transmits the at least one TOTP token to the second computing device. The first user enters the at least one TOTP token into the first computing device. The account can then be validated and MFA enabled.
